body {
background-color:#000000;
background-image:url("../images/fond.jpg");
background-position:left top;
background-repeat:no-repeat;
margin:0px;
color:#fff;
font-family:'Arial';
font-size:1em;
width:100%;
}
img{
border:none;
}
img, li, div,  { behavior: url(pngfix/iepngfix.htc) }
.separation{
clear:both;
visibility:hidden;
}

#header{
width:600px;
height:135px;
}
#header img{
margin: 3% 0 3% 2%;
}

#panoramique{
background-image:url("../images/panoramique.jpg");
margin: 0 0 5% 0;
background-repeat:repeat-x;
height:235px;
width:100%;
}

.corps{
position:relative;

width:100%;
height:auto;
margin:1% auto;
padding:35px 0 0 0;
border:1px solid #fff;
}

#corner1{
width:39px;
height:39px;
position:absolute;
top:2.5%;
left:10%;
}
#corner2{
width:39px;
height:39px;
position:absolute;
top:8%;
left:85.8%;
}
.corps p{
width:72%;
font-size:1em;
text-align:justify;
margin:20px auto 40px auto;

}
.corps span{
color:#4d66af;
font-weight:bold;
}

.onglet{
width:90%;
height:38px;
margin:0 auto;
background-image:url("../images/onglet.jpg");
background-position:left top;
background-repeat:no-repeat;
}
.onglet h1{
color:#4d66af;
font-size:120%;
padding: 0;
display:block;
width:300px;
height:39px;
text-align:center;
line-height:39px;
vertical-align:center;

}
.onglet a{
color:#4d66af;
text-decoration:none;

}
.rectangle{
position:relative;
width:90%;
height:auto;
margin:0 auto ;
padding: 0 0 20px 0;
background-color:#131210;
border:1px solid #3b3b3b;
}
.rectangle img{
height:215px;
margin:20px 0 0 20px;
width:300px;
}
.bouton-entrer{
width:90%;
margin:0 auto 50px auto;
text-align:right;
}
.rec-gauche{
float:left;
width:40%;
text-align:center;
}
.rec-gauche img{
text-align:center;
}
.rec-droite{
position:relative;
float:right;
width:56%;
height:260px;
}
.rec-droite a{
text-decoration:none;
color:#4d66af;
font-weight:bold;
}
.rec-droite p{
width:90%;
height:auto;
margin: 0 auto;
padding:50px 0 0 0;
text-indent:15px;
font-size:1em;
}
.rec-droite img{
margin:0;
padding:0;
}
#corner3{
width:39px;
height:39px;
position:absolute;
top:2%;
left:0%;
}
#corner3 img, #corner4 img{
width:100%;
height:100%;

}
#corner4{
width:39px;
height:39px;
position:absolute;
bottom:0%;
right:2%;
}
#corner5{
width:39px;
height:39px;
position:absolute;
top:16%;
left:5%;
}
#corner6{
width:39px;
height:39px;
position:absolute;
top:61%;
left:44%;
}
#contact-accueil {
float:left;
width:100%;
height:160px;
padding:0;
font-size:1.3em;
color:#4d66af;
margin: 10% 0 0 20%;
}
span.contact-accueil {
color:#fff;
}
#page-flash-contact{
text-align:right;

width:100%;
margin:0 auto;
}
#page-flash-contact p{
text-align:center;
}
#page-flash-contact a{
color:#4366af;
}

#qui{
text-align:center;
position:relative;
float:right;
width:50%;
height:282px;
margin: 0;
}

#footer{
height:60px;
width:100%;
background-color:#4d66af;
margin:50px 0;
}
#footer p{
color:#000000;
font-size:0.75em;
padding:15px 0 0;
text-align:center;
}

/*VISITES VIRTUELLES*/
h1{
color:#4d66af;
font-family:'Arial';
}



